From 02089be872e2642082dc8ff80a13c059e20d74f5 Mon Sep 17 00:00:00 2001 From: Jan Calanog Date: Mon, 28 Jul 2025 22:21:47 +0200 Subject: [PATCH 1/2] Force autofocus of search input --- .../web-components/SearchOrAskAi/SearchOrAskAiModal.tsx |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/Elastic.Documentation.Site/Assets/web-components/SearchOrAskAi/SearchOrAskAiModal.tsx b/src/Elastic.Documentation.Site/Assets/web-components/SearchOrAskAi/SearchOrAskAiModal.tsx index bbf4a1d06..f4b8074a9 100644 --- a/src/Elastic.Documentation.Site/Assets/web-components/SearchOrAskAi/SearchOrAskAiModal.tsx +++ b/src/Elastic.Documentation.Site/Assets/web-components/SearchOrAskAi/SearchOrAskAiModal.tsx @@ -10,12 +10,13 @@ import { } from '@elastic/eui' import { css } from '@emotion/react' import * as React from 'react' +import { useEffect } from "react"; export const SearchOrAskAiModal = () => { const searchTerm = useSearchTerm() const askAiTerm = useAskAiTerm() const { setSearchTerm, submitAskAiTerm } = useSearchActions() - + return ( <> { submitAskAiTerm(e) }} isClearable + autoFocus={true} /> {askAiTerm ? : } From 1a143644cd7332ed335deec6b72136395c8442b5 Mon Sep 17 00:00:00 2001 From: Jan Calanog Date: Tue, 29 Jul 2025 00:38:45 +0200 Subject: [PATCH 2/2] Apply suggestion from @reakaleek --- .../Assets/web-components/SearchOrAskAi/SearchOrAskAiModal.tsx | 1 - 1 file changed, 1 deletion(-) diff --git a/src/Elastic.Documentation.Site/Assets/web-components/SearchOrAskAi/SearchOrAskAiModal.tsx b/src/Elastic.Documentation.Site/Assets/web-components/SearchOrAskAi/SearchOrAskAiModal.tsx index f4b8074a9..4ed99531a 100644 --- a/src/Elastic.Documentation.Site/Assets/web-components/SearchOrAskAi/SearchOrAskAiModal.tsx +++ b/src/Elastic.Documentation.Site/Assets/web-components/SearchOrAskAi/SearchOrAskAiModal.tsx @@ -10,7 +10,6 @@ import { } from '@elastic/eui' import { css } from '@emotion/react' import * as React from 'react' -import { useEffect } from "react"; export const SearchOrAskAiModal = () => { const searchTerm = useSearchTerm()